How Our Floodwater Removal Service Actually Works

With floodwater removal, the process might seem straightforward, but it’s actually a complex series of steps that need precision and care. Our team starts by assessing the damage, identifying the source of the flooding, and developing a customized plan to get your home back to normal. Here’s a closer look at what we do:

Assessment and Planning

Inspecting every inch of your property to identify the extent of the damage, locating all sources of moisture and developing a personalized plan to get your home dry and safe.

Water Extraction

Using specialized equipment to extract standing water from your home’s floors, walls, and ceilings, reducing water damage and preventing mold growth.

Drying and Dehumidification

Setting up industrial-strength drying equipment to speed up the evaporation process and preventing secondary damage from water seepage and condensation.

Sanitizing and Disinfecting

Using EPA-registered cleaning agents to sanitize and disinfect all affected areas, removing bacteria and mold spores and ensuring a safe living space.

Final Inspection and Repair

Conducting a thorough inspection to ensure your home is completely dry and safe, identifying any areas that need repair and getting you back to normal as quickly as possible.

Warning Signs You Need Floodwater Removal

Catching floodwater-related damage early on saves you money and prevents b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Visible Water Damage

Water stains on your ceiling or walls warped flooring and visible signs of moisture are all indicators that you need professional help.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ant smells that linger long after the flooding has stopped may be a sign of mold or bacteria growth, don’t ignore it!

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Distorted flooring can be a sign of water damage that’s spreading, get it checked out ASAP.

Purple Stains on Your Walls

These unsightly stains can show the presence of mold or mildew, don’t delay in getting it treated.

High Humidity Levels

Moisture in the air can lead to mold growth and secondary damage, keep an eye on the humidity levels in your home.

Cracks in Your Foundation

Cracks in your foundation can be a sign of water damage that’s spreading, get it inspected and repaired ASAP.

Floodwater Removal Cost in Poulsbo, WA

The cost of floodwater removal in Poulsbo, WA can vary greatly dep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. As a general estimate, expect to pay anywhere from $500 to $2,500 or more for a full-scale floodwater removal service. Keep in mind that these are just estimates, and the actual cost will depend on the specifics of your situ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,000 Depends on the amount of standing water and equipment needed.
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Varies based on the size of the affected area and equipment required.
Sanitizing and disinfecting $500 – $2,000 Depends on the size of the area and the severity of the damage.
Final inspection and repair $1,000 – $5,000 Varies based on the extent of the damage and materials needed for repairs.

Can I prevent floodwater damage from happening in the first place?

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ent floodwater damage from occurring in the first place. Regularly inspecting your home’s gutters and downspouts, ensuring proper grading around your home, and installing a sump pump can all help to prevent floodwater-related damage. Also, keeping an eye out for warning signs like water stains, warping flooring, and musty odors can help you catch issues early on and prevent bigger problems from developing.
